One of the primary benefits of commercial fire rated glass doors is their enhanced safety features. These doors are typically made with tempered or laminated glass, which can withstand high temperatures and prevent fire from passing through. For instance, doors with a fire rating of 22 minutes are designed to hold back flames and smoke, allowing occupants more time to evacuate in case of an emergency.
Furthermore, these doors often come with a fire resistance rating that indicates how long they can endure exposure to fire. It's essential when selecting doors to ensure they meet local safety codes and fire regulations.

In many jurisdictions, fire rated glass doors are required to comply with local and national building codes, particularly in commercial settings. Installing these doors ensures that your property adheres to safety standards, thereby reducing potential liabilities. Failure to conform to these regulations can result in fines or complications with legal claims in case of emergencies.
Additionally, compliance with fire safety codes is vital for insurance purposes. Insurance companies often look for safety protocols when determining premiums or handling claims related to fire damage.

Commercial fire rated glass doors are highly versatile and can be used in various applications, from office buildings to shopping centers. They can be installed as entrance doors, interior office partitions, or even in hallways. This flexibility allows architects and builders to maintain a cohesive design while ensuring safety measures are in place.
Moreover, these doors are available in various designs and sizes, making them suitable for any architectural style. Whether you’re going for a modern look or something more traditional, there’s a fire rated glass door that can fit your vision.
